Farmer’s Market Finds

It’s easy to get lost in a farmer’s market. Rows upon rows of beautiful, bountiful produce line the walls and bright colors and sweet, earthy scents abound.
Everything is of the freshest quality- some bins hold tomatoes still on the vine, others hold sprigs of cut and bundled herbs, and still others house berries wet with juice.
Filling up the cart is a thrilling experience, knowing that once I get home, I’ll make pies, soups, and even dips out of the harvest we bought.
